To the girl who welcomed me with open arms to the place I now call home,

Coming to college, no one ever knows what to expect. With new surroundings, new people and new experiences, things can get a little crazy. Without you, who knows where I would be. Between our daily rants, late night food trips, sappy girl nights, and spontaneous dance outbreaks, you have made my college experience so far one that I could never forget. And between midterms and all of the hustle and bustle of week five, I think it's time you get a little recognition for it.

Thank you for being willing to take spontaneous trips into the city when we are swamped with work. I wouldn't want to procrastinate with anyone else.

Thank you for letting me ugly cry and throw tissues everywhere when boys are being dumb. You didn't have to pick up my snotty tissues, but you did anyway.

Thank you for planning revenge on those stupid boys when I go on a rant. I was never serious about plotting their doom, but I know you would be standing right next to me if I was.

Thank you for gently reminding me to "fold my damn laundry" when the pile of clean clothes turns into Mt. Everest. At least, they're clean, right?

Thank you for tucking me into bed and setting a glass of water by my bedside when I've had a long night. I will be especially grateful for that in the morning.

Thank you for having long, 3 a.m. talks about our lives when we can't sleep. Even if they are just about how cute the guy down the hall's butt is.

Thank you for encouraging me to push myself through my school work. And thank you for yelling and screaming at me when we can't take schoolwork anymore.

Thank you for jumping into bed with me and watching youtube videos when I'm feeling sad. Your company is all I need to feel better.

Thank you for being that "basic white girl" when we see each other on the streets. The screams and the running toward each other are completely necessary.

Thank you for bringing me food and DayQuil to my bed when the I catch the Drexel Plague. And thank you for accepting that you'll probably catch it from me, so you don't mind snuggling my snot-nosed self.

Thank you for always having my back, even if you don't agree with my decisions. And thank you for telling me I'm being stupid when I need to hear it.

And most of all, thank you for being the stunning, inspiring young woman you are. You brighten my mood each day, and I don't know how I would make it through this stage in our lives without you.

Thank you for being you, ya' crazy cat.

With love,
Your roomie.
